The paper explores the applications of iota quiver algebras and Dynkin miniver algebras in the Nakajima-Keller-Scherotzke categories, and provides a geometric construction of universal iota quantum groups for quantum symmetric pairs.
The iota quiver algebras were introduced recently by the authors to provide a Hall algebra realization of universal iota quantum groups, which is a generalization of Bridgeland's Hall algebra construction for (Drinfeld doubles of) quantum groups; here an iota quantum group and a corresponding Drinfeld-Jimbo quantum group form a quantum symmetric pair. In this paper, the Dynkin miniver algebras are shown to arise as new examples of singular Nakajima-Keller-Scherotzke categories. Then we provide a geometric construction of the universal iota quantum groups and their dual canonical bases with positivity, via the quantum Grothendieck rings of Nakajima-Keller-Scherotzke quiver varieties, generalizing Qin's geometric realization of quantum groups of type ADE.
